Как организованы комплексы обработки инцидентов в текущем времени
Механизмы обработки происшествий в реальном времени представляют собой комплекс программных модулей, которые принимают, анализируют и преобразуют массивы данных с незначительной латентностью. Такие системы работают непрерывно, гарантируя быструю отклик на приходящую данные.
Фундамент структуры составляют три основных элемента: источники событий, обработчики и хранилища данных. Источники производят непрерывный последовательность данных через специальные соединения. Обработчики осуществляют фильтрацию, трансформацию и объединение данных согласно указанным нормам.
Современные системы задействуют распределённую структуру для достижения значительной эффективности. Приходящие инциденты разделяются между множеством компонентов обработки, что позволяет кабура казино увеличиваться горизонтально и обслуживать миллионы событий в секунду.
Ключевым параметром является время отклика — промежуток между приемом инцидента и предоставлением результата. Качественные решения преобразуют сведения за миллисекунды, что принципиально для экономических переводов и комплексов защиты.
Источники событий: датчики, приложения, логи, транзакции и пользовательские операции
Инциденты поступают в платформу из разнообразных источников, каждый из которых создает уникальный класс данных. Сенсоры промышленного техники отправляют данные температуры, давления, вибрации и прочих физических показателей с частотой до сотен снятий в секунду.
Веб-приложения и мобильные службы генерируют события при работе пользователя с интерфейсом. Нажатия, посещения страниц, внесение товаров формируют постоянный поток действий. Серверные приложения фиксируют вызовы к API и корректировки состояния сессий.
Системные логи фиксируют технические происшествия: ошибки, предупреждения, информационные уведомления о деятельности архитектуры. Выделенные агенты собирают записи с серверов и контейнеров, передавая их в cabura для единой обработки.
Финансовые операции формируют критически важные происшествия при операциях и платежах. Банковские системы производят записи о каждой операции с картой и корректировке баланса. Торговые платформы регистрируют ордера на закупку и сбыт активов.
Построение поточной преобразования
Поточная преобразование базируется на концепции непрерывного перемещения данных через череду модулей без промежуточного записи. Инциденты идут через череду изменений, где каждый компонент осуществляет конкретную операцию: фильтрацию, расширение, агрегацию или распределение.
Фундаментальная структура включает ярус принятия данных, который принимает инциденты из сторонних источников и переводит их в унифицированный шаблон. Последующий уровень реализует бизнес-логику: вычисляет метрики, находит аномалии, использует правила обработки. Результаты направляются в уровень экспорта для сохранения или отправки.
Нынешние системы поддерживают два способа к обработке. Первый обрабатывает каждое инцидент персонально сразу после принятия. Второй формирует инциденты в микропакеты и обрабатывает их с периодом в несколько секунд. Определение определяется от критериев к задержке и количеству данных.
Элементы архитектуры коммуницируют через унифицированные каналы, что дает менять отдельные модули без модификации целой платформы. кабура обеспечивает гибкость при корректировке запросов.
Очереди и каналы данных: как инциденты передаются между сервисами
Отправка инцидентов между компонентами структуры реализуется через специализированные инструменты транспортировки данными. Очереди уведомлений обеспечивают устойчивую передачу данных от отправителей к потребителям с обеспечением целостности при сбоях.
Каналы данных составляют собой распределённые платформы для публикации и регистрации на потоки инцидентов. Отправители отправляют уведомления в именованные очереди, а потребители регистрируются на интересующие разделы. Такая модель дает отдельному инциденту достигать совокупности получателей единовременно.
Главные свойства платформ транспортировки происшествий содержат:
- Пропускную мощность — объем уведомлений в отрезок времени
- Задержку доставки — время между отправкой и принятием
- Гарантии доставки — показатель стабильности доставки
- Очередность — поддержание последовательности событий
Механизмы промежуточного хранения накапливают происшествия при кратковременной отсутствии адресатов. cabura фиксирует данные на накопителе до момента успешной обработки. Дублирование между серверами исключает исчезновение информации при аварии машин.
Схемы обработки
Системы реального времени применяют различные схемы обработки событий в зависимости от бизнес-требований и специфики данных. Каждая схема задает метод группировки, изучения и трансформации входящих потоков.
Обслуживание отдельных происшествий анализирует каждое уведомление изолированно от иных. Платформа задействует правила отбора и обогащения к каждой строке немедленно после приема. Такой способ снижает латентности и годится для существенных сценариев с условием немедленной ответа.
Интервальная преобразование объединяет события по временным промежуткам или количеству элементов. Комплекс накапливает данные в протяжение заданного отрезка, затем осуществляет агрегацию и подсчет метрик. Периоды могут быть постоянными, скользящими или пользовательскими в зависимости от алгоритма сервиса.
Преобразование с поддержанием статуса поддерживает контекст между происшествиями. Платформа фиксирует промежуточные данные, индикаторы, накопленные показатели для будущих расчетов. кабура казино применяет распределённое репозиторий для обеспечения целостности. Схема без статуса обслуживает события самостоятельно, что улучшает масштабирование.
Сохранение данных: горячие (real-time) и долгосрочные (архивные) уровни
Архитектура размещения данных в системах реального времени распределяется на несколько уровней в связи от интенсивности запроса и запросов к темпу чтения. Такое распределение улучшает расходы и обеспечивает равновесие между производительностью и стоимостью.
Оперативный слой содержит актуальные данные, к которым требуется моментальный доступ. Сведения располагается в временной памяти или на производительных SSD-дисках для сокращения времени реакции. Хранилища этого уровня обрабатывают тысячи обращений в секунду. Период сохранения равен от нескольких часов до нескольких дней.
Промежуточный уровень сохраняет данные промежуточного давности для исследования и документирования. События перемещаются сюда автоматически после истечения времени релевантности. кабура обеспечивает соотношение между темпом обращения и количеством размещения.
Холодный архивный ярус применяется для долгосрочного сохранения прошлых информации. Информация помещается на экономичных накопителях с низкоскоростным доступом. Архивы эксплуатируются для выполнения условиям контролеров, ревизии и изучения тенденций. Интервал хранения может составлять нескольких лет.
Увеличение и устойчивость
Умение платформы обслуживать расширяющиеся количества данных и удерживать дееспособность при авариях определяет её стабильность в рабочей окружении. Построение должна содержать механизмы горизонтального увеличения и копирования критичных компонентов.
Горизонтальное масштабирование включает свежие узлы обработки при повышении загрузки. Инциденты автоматом разделяются между свободными машинами согласно правилам распределения. Комплекс активно подстраивается к модификации массива данных без прерывания.
Инструменты достижения надежности cabura содержат:
- Репликацию данных между узлами для исключения потерь
- Автоматизированное смену на дублирующие модули при сбое
- Фиксирующие точки для удержания положения обслуживания
- Восстановление с возобновлением с последнего сохранённого статуса
Распределение загрузки осуществляется на основе идентификаторов партиционирования, которые задают направление происшествий к обработчикам. кабура казино обеспечивает согласованную преобразование связанных происшествий на отдельном узле. Отслеживание работоспособности узлов дает выявлять ухудшение производительности и перенаправлять задачи.
Отслеживание и уведомление: как следят положение массивов и отвечают на отклонения
Постоянное контроль за статусом системы обработки происшествий дает обнаруживать сбои до их критического эффекта на бизнес-процессы. Средства отслеживания собирают параметры производительности и формируют предупреждения при вариациях от типичных показателей.
Главные метрики включают скорость приема происшествий, латентность обработки, объем очередей и процент сбоев. Комплексы отслеживают загрузку CPU, использование памяти и дискового места на узлах группы. Чарты отображают динамику метрик в реальном времени.
Предельные параметры определяют границы стандартного работы для каждой параметра. При переходе порогов комплекс автоматически производит сигналы для операторов. кабура дает конфигурировать правила алертинга с рассмотрением серьезности различных типов событий.
Анализ отклонений задействует статистические подходы для выявления аномальных шаблонов в последовательностях данных. Процедуры выявляют острые всплески трафика, нетипичные череды инцидентов, странную деятельность. Самостоятельные действия охватывают увеличение мощностей, перенаправление на альтернативные пути или сокращение приходящего трафика.
Случаи эксплуатации механизмов обработки происшествий
Денежные организации применяют системы обработки инцидентов для обнаружения мошеннических транзакций. Процедуры исследуют каждую действие по карте в instant проведения, сравнивая с предыдущими шаблонами действий пользователя. При определении сомнительной деятельности система останавливает операцию за миллисекунды.
Интернет-магазины эксплуатируют непрерывную преобразование для адаптации советов товаров. Инциденты просмотра страниц, внесения в корзину и покупок преобразуются в реальном времени. Платформа производит релевантные советы на фундаменте настоящего активности посетителя.
Производственные предприятия развертывают наблюдение аппаратуры для прогнозного поддержки. Измерители на производственных линиях посылают величины колебаний, температуры и расхода энергии. кабура казино анализирует сведения и предсказывает вероятные неисправности, что дает планировать восстановление без аварийных простоев.
Перевозочные фирмы следят перемещение товаров и улучшают пути транспортировки. GPS-трекеры производят координаты автомобильных автомобилей каждые несколько секунд. Платформа анализирует пробки и важность заказов для оперативной модификации траекторий и оповещения клиентов о времени прибытия.
